














[SN CIJ Q067115] USED FENDER JAPAN (-2015) / ST62-70TX Black [20]
This '62-style model is equipped with USA-made Texas Special pickups.
It features an alder body, a maple neck, a 7.25R rosewood fingerboard, Kluson tuners, a 5-way selector switch, and Texas Special pickups.
This is a classic Strat with an alder body and rosewood fingerboard, paired with Texas Special pickups known for their crisp midrange.
